Bled (Slovenia) - Speaking in Bled, Slovenia, Czech Prime Minister Andrej Babiš called for the creation of coalitions of European Union member states that would defend the interests of the Czech Republic and Central Europe in the areas of competitiveness and cohesion funds at the EU level when negotiating the next EU budget. The 21st Bled Strategic Forum began today in Bled, where the government of Janez Janša will host heads of state and government, ministers, diplomats and experts in one place for two days.
